Costs of Tweed improvements to terminals to accommodate Avelo rise up to $11 million

Mark Zaretsky Sep. 28, 2021 | Updated: Sep. 28, 2021 3:54 p.m.

Artists renderings show concepts of what the new terminal at Tweed New Haven Regional Airport could look like in the project proposed by Avports and the Tweed authority on May 6, 2021. The 74,000-square-foot terminal would be located on the East Haven side of the airport and the old terminal on the New Haven side would be retired. Target for completion was announced as the end of 2023.Courtesy of Avports

(nhregister.com Sept 28, 2021) NEW HAVEN — The cost estimate has more than doubled for near-term improvements to Tweed New Haven Regional Airport’s existing facilities on the New Haven side of the airport to accommodate Avelo Airlines’ upcoming service, Tweed officials said Tuesday.
